> It seems that when there is a repo without signatures and it tries to
> install a package from there it fails.

You have a choice... you can disable gpg sig checking on the
development repository via the repository definition file you are
using.. or you can continue to enforce the sig checking and live
without the packages in the development tree that have not been signed
yet.
